Based on your answers you are ...
SKAE
SKAE players enjoy teamwork and cooperation, but feel that the main challenges of a virtual world come from the other players rather than the environment. They enjoy forming groups and alliances that will pit themselves against other players--and they gain the most satisfaction when they defeat organized groups of other players. When they aren't playing against other players, they enjoy all of the social aspects of the game.

Though I can honestly say I didn't understand some of the questions (I assume they relate to games like world of warcraft or something like that which I really DESPISE those type of games)
AEKS
AEKS players are interested in the player-versus-environment aspect of the game more than anything else. They are often soloists who want to achieve and see what the world has to offer. Often, they find groups cumbersome and PVP to be more an annoyance than a feature.
Breakdown: Achiever 73.33%, Explorer 73.33%, Killer 53.33%, Socializer 0.00%
I notice I have a 0.00% of socializing, I think I understand that. I don't ever want in my life to know the definition of the word "Guild" as it relates to computers.

KASE
KASE players tends to enjoy the PVP aspect most of all, but also likes to pit themself against all the challenges of the PVE environment as well--although the latter is often a means to an end. This type of player will often enjoy PVP that focuses on their skill as an individual contributor (duels, and so forth) more than team-based PVP.
Breakdown: Achiever 53.33%, Explorer 26.67%, Killer 93.33%, Socializer 26.67%
